Access数据库应用技术
A OpenForm B OpenQuery C OpenTable D OpenModule 参考答案B
28 宏操作SetValue可以设置
A 窗体或报表控件的设置 B 刷新控件数据 C 字段的值 D 当前系统的时间 参考答案A
60 不能够使用宏的数据库对象是 A 数据表 B 窗体 C 宏 D 报表 参考答案A
61 在下列关于宏和模块的叙述中,正确的是 A 模块是能够被程序调用的函数 B 通过定义宏可以选择或更新数据
C 宏或模块都不能是窗体或报表上的事件代码
D 宏可以是独立的数据库对象,可以提供独立的操作动作 参考答案D
97 要限制宏命令的操作范围,可以在创建宏时定义 A 宏操作对象 B 宏条件表达式 C 窗体或报表控件属性 D 宏操作目标 参考答案B
126 在运行宏的过程中,宏不能修改的是 A 窗体 B 宏本身 C 表 D 数据库 参考答案B
127 在设计条件宏时,对于连续重复条件,要代替重复条件表达式可是使用符号 A … B : C ! D = 参考答案A
129 宏操作Quit的功能是
A 关闭表 B 退出宏 C 退出查询 D 退出Access 参考答案D
163 下列操作中,适合使用宏的是 A 修改数据表结构 B 创建自定义过程 C 打开或关闭报表对象 D 处理报表中错误 参考答案C
196 为窗体或报表的控件设置属性值的正确宏操作命令是 A Set B SetData C SetValue D SetWarnings 参考答案C
212 .在宏的表达式中还可能引用到窗体或报表上控件的值。引用窗体控件的值可以用表达式(A Forms!窗体名!控件名 B Forms!控件名 C Forms!窗体名 D 窗体名!控件名 参考答案A
335 定义( )有利于对数据库中宏对象的管理。 A 宏 B 宏组 C 数组 D 窗体 参考答案B
340 宏是一个或多个( )的集合。 A 事件 B 操作 C 关系 D 记录 参考答案B
350 要限制宏命令的操作范围,可以在创建宏时定义( )。 A 宏操作对象 B 宏条件表达式 C 窗体或报表控件属性 D 宏操作目标 参考答案B
25
)。 Access数据库应用技术
360 在一个数据库中已经设置了自动宏AutoExec,如果在打开数据库的时候不想执行这个自动宏,正确的操作是( )。 A 用Enter键打开数据库 B 打开数据库时按住Alt键 C 打开数据库时按住Ctrl键 D 打开数据库时按住Shift键 参考答案D
363 某窗体中有一命令按钮,在窗体视图中单击此命令按钮打开另一个窗体,需要执行的宏操作是( )。 A OpenQuery B OpenReport C OpenWindow D OpenForm 参考答案D
366 在一个宏的操作序列中,如果既包含带条件的操作,又包含无条件的操作。则带条件的操作是否执行取决于条件式的真假,而没有指定条件的操作则会( )。 A 无条件执行 B 有条件执行 C 不执行 D 出错 参考答案A
367 能够创建宏的设计器是( )。 A 窗体设计器 B 报表设计器 C 表设计器 D 宏设计器 参考答案D
368 有多个操作构成的宏,执行时是按( )依次执行的。 A 排序次序 B 输入顺序 C 从后往前 D 打开顺序 参考答案A
369 下列命令中,属于通知或警告用户的命令是( )。 A Restore B Requery C Msgbox D RunApp 参考答案C
371 VBA的自动运行宏,必须命名为( )。 A AutoExec B AutoExe C Auto D AutoExec.bat 参考答案A
378 打开查询的宏操作是( )。 A OpenForm B OpenQuery C OpenTable D OpenModule 参考答案B
八、模块与VBA编程基础
19 在一个Access的表中有字段“专业”,要查找包含“信息”两个字的记录,正确的条件表达式是 A =left([专业],2)=\信息\ B like \信息*\C =\信息*\ D Mid([专业],2)=\信息\参考答案B
29 使用Function语句定义一个函数过程,其返回值的类型 A 只能是符号常量
B 是除数组之外的简单数据类型 C 可在调用时由运行过程决定 D 由函数定义时As子句声明 参考答案D
30 在过程定义中有语句:
Private Sub GetData(ByRef f As Integer) 其中\的含义是
26
Access数据库应用技术
A 传值调用 B 传址调用 C 形式参数 D 实际参数 参考答案B
32 在窗体中有一个标签Label0,标题为“测试进行中”;有一个命令按钮Command1,事件代码如下: Private Sub Command1_Click() Label0.Caption=\标签\End Sub
Private Sub Form_Load() Form.Caption=\举例\Command1.Caption=\移动\End Sub
打开窗体后单击命令按钮,屏幕显示
A
B
C
D
参考答案BD
33 在窗体中有一个标签Lb1和一个命令按钮Command1,事件代码如下:
27
Access数据库应用技术
Option Compare Database Dim a As String * 10
Private Sub Command1_Click() a=\b=Len(a) Me.Lb1.Caption=b End Sub
打开窗体后单击命令按钮,窗体中显示的内容是 A 4 B 5 C 10 D 40 参考答案C???
34 下列不是分支结构的语句是 A If...Then...EndIf B While...WEnd C If...Then...Else...EndIf D Select...Case...End Select 参考答案B
35 在窗体中使有一个文本框(名为n)接受输入的值,有一个命令按钮run,事件代码如下: Private Sub run_Click() result=\For i=1 To Me!n For j=1 To Me!n result=result+\Next j
result=result+Chr(13)+Chr(10) Next i MsgBox result End Sub
打开窗体后,如果通过文本框输入的值为4,单击命令按钮后输出的图型是 A **** **** **** **** B * *** ***** ******* C
**** ****** ******** ********** D **** **** **** **** 参考答案A
62 VBA 程序流程控制的方式是
28